PRESIDENT TINUBU RESHUFFLES SERVICE CHIEFS

President Bola Ahmed Tinubu has approved changes in the leadership of the Nigerian Armed Forces as part of efforts to strengthen the nation’s security architecture.

In the new appointments, General Olufemi Oluyede replaces General Christopher Musa as the Chief of Defence Staff. Major-General W. Shaibu has been named the new Chief of Army Staff, while Air Vice Marshal S.K. Aneke assumes office as the Chief of Air Staff. The new Chief of Naval Staff is Rear Admiral I. Abbas.

The Chief of Defence Intelligence, Major-General E.A.P. Undiendeye, retains his position.

President Tinubu, who also serves as the Commander-in-Chief of the Armed Forces, expressed deep appreciation to the outgoing Chief of Defence Staff, General Christopher Musa, and other departing Service Chiefs for their patriotic service and dedicated leadership.

He urged the newly appointed Service Chiefs to justify the confidence reposed in them by demonstrating greater professionalism, vigilance, and unity in the discharge of their duties.

All appointments take immediate effect.
